
It’s well known that ERP Implementation requires, above all, time and money. It can be said globally that these two elements represent a cumulative effect of many critical success factors (CSFs) of ERP implementation. Without diminishing the importance of time, the cost component of ERP implementation may be significantly increased by the hidden costs of implementation, which in the phase of supply and contracting are not seen as separate items. This paper presents the research on hidden costs of ERP implementation in small and medium-sized (SME) manufacturing companies in Croatia.
